Félix Navarro Rodríguez, political exprisoner and dissident, arrived at the José Martí International Airport. Once he got his luggage, immigration officers immediately taken him to the office and completely searched all his personal belongings. It took more then 6 hours and and the officers confiscated him two cell phones, pictures of Virgin Mary and Osvaldo Payá - deceased Cuban dissident, t-shirts with political slogans, business cards and books.
